Baroque elegance shines through in J. S. Bach's BWV 1004 Giga, characterized by a lively 108 BPM and rich emotional depth. Composed in Dm, the piece flows with a captivating 12/8 time signature, offering a rhythmic complexity that enhances its spirited nature.
This MIDI arrangement features an Acoustic Grand Piano, boasting a note count of 908 over a brief duration of just 2:13. With a track count of 2, it's ideal for practice, remixing, or creating dynamic visualizers, allowing musicians to engage deeply with Bach's timeless composition.
